Transaction 3b62307118856661aa725a3d8070c18ac079cf81614089e9137934eb47214033

1 Input
2 Outputs
  • 3b62307118856661aa725a3d8070c18ac079cf81614089e9137934eb47214033:0
  • value  2118173
    address  n3FunMye4ua7s7r35Ed4v2KcmJRmZKYyVp
  • 3b62307118856661aa725a3d8070c18ac079cf81614089e9137934eb47214033:1
  • value  1944788108
    address  2MzgcVT4MM6bDWUpSp5rJFqYd1aRZ3m8a1S